plenteous

adjective
/ˈplɛntɪəs/

Meaning

existing in great quantity; abundant

Example Sentences

The harvest was plenteous, providing enough food for the entire village.

Synonyms

abundant, plentiful, rich, bountiful

Antonyms

scarce, insufficient

Collocations

plenteous harvest, plenteous supply, plenteous resources
